Output 85b5c69cf73bbf9b4989948ecd821fe23ff588a04d7c7f0d02e018be6e8839b8:0

value
2621062
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ce72b6a050a384ea4597aa2732671107bcb783f1 OP_EQUAL
address
3LWcYVAgCE3TgFVqzLjumXBoPLwNHDH3vu
transaction
85b5c69cf73bbf9b4989948ecd821fe23ff588a04d7c7f0d02e018be6e8839b8
spent
true